"Bid at 1999 yuan for a 32-inch TV, in fact, results in a loss," said a black electric manager of a home appliance chain store. He introduced that the current procurement price of a 32-inch LCD panel is about 1122 yuan, and the manufacturing cost of the whole machine is about 1780 yuan. Adding the channel profit and taxes, the retail price of 1999 yuan is a loss-making price for manufacturers. Seven brands including LeHua, ChuangJia, and SuoJia have all bid successfully on their 32-inch LCD TVs, with a capped price of 1999 yuan. However, currently, the lowest market price for a 32-inch TV remains at 2550 yuan. Also, none of the successful bidders have started selling their 32-inch models in the market yet. He stated that bidding within the price cap mainly looks forward to the prospects of LCD TVs in the rural market, "Bidding only happens once a year, and if in several months or half a year later, the price of the upstream screen drops, then the companies that successfully bid on the 32-inch TVs will have greater advantages in the rural market."
